עדכון כותרת עמוד בממשק ניהול בוורדפרס לכותרת מותאמת אישית

בתור ברירת מחדל כותרת עמוד בממשק ניהול בוורדפרס היא "וורדפרס – שם האתר > שם העמוד". לדוגמה: עמוד ניהול פוסטים יהיה "וורדפרס – amaze.website > פוסטים".

כמה סיבות אפשרויות להסיר את המילה "וורדפרס" מכותרת העמוד:

  • שם העמוד עצמו יכול להיות מוסתר בגלל עודף מלל בראש הלשונית בדפדפן.
  • אם שם האתר ארוך, לא נראה כלל את שם העמוד כי הרוחב של לשונית הדפדפן קבוע. הדבר יכול להפריע בעיקר כשעובדים על כמה  לשוניות יחד ורוצים לדפדפן בין לשונית ללשונית בדפדפן.
  • בהדפסת עמודים / ייצוא קובץ PDF מהעמוד דרך פלגינים מסויימים שם העמוד יופיע בראש, ולא תמיד רלוונטי המילה "וורדפרס" בכותרת העמוד כשמגישים את הפלט/הדף המודפס.

מדוע שלא נסיר את המילה "וורדפרס" מהכותרת אם היא מיותרת? אנחנו או הגולש מודעים מן הסתם שהגלישה כרגע בתוך ממשק ניהול של אתר וורדפרס.

שינוי כותרת עמוד ממשק ניהול וורדפרס
כותרת עמוד בממשק ניהול בוורדפרס

איך לשנות את כותרת עמוד בממשק ניהול בוורדפרס לכותרת מותאמת אישית:

אופן ביצוע: להעתיק ולהדביק לתוך הקובץ functions.php בתבנית בת של התבנית שלנו והכותרת תשתנה.

// Reomve "Wordpress from pages title"
add_filter('admin_title', 'my_admin_title', 10, 2);

function my_admin_title($admin_title, $title){
    return get_bloginfo('name').' • '.$title;
}

להלן צילום מסך עם התוצאה. כמו שאפשר לראות מופיע במקרה הזה בראש הלשונית "פוסטים <כדור> amaze.website" – יותר ידידותי ונעים לעין.

כותרת עמוד בממשק ניהול בוורדפרס

בקוד לעיל המפריד בין שם האתר לשם העמוד, הוא "כדור", שהוא ברשימת תגים מיוחדים בHTML, אבל ניתן להחליף איתו בכל אות אחרת / תו HTML אחר מרשימת תווים מיוחדים של HTML.

כמו כן ניתן להסיר לגמרי את שם האתר על ידי השארת רק $title בשורה כמו הקוד הבא:

// Reomve "Wordpress from pages title"
add_filter('admin_title', 'my_admin_title', 10, 2);

function my_admin_title($admin_title, $title){
    return $title;
}

אם מדובר באתר עם משתמשים שמתחברים לממשק ניהול לבצע פעולות שונות, ניתן לתת הרגשה יותר "קסטום" למשתמשים על ידי להוסיף את הכינוי שלהם לכותרת במקום שם האתר. לדוגמה:

// Reomve "Wordpress from pages title"
add_filter('admin_title', 'my_admin_title', 10, 2);

function my_admin_title($admin_title, $title){
    $current_user = wp_get_current_user();
    return $title .' • '. $current_user->user_login;
}

אלו רק 3 כיוונים שונים לדוגמה, אם יש לכם/ן רעיונות נוספים מה אפשר להשים בכותרת של העמוד בניהול נא להוסיף בתגובות ואשמח להוסיף לתוך המאמר קוד רלוונטי.

כתיבת תגובה

האימייל לא יוצג באתר. שדות החובה מסומנים *